Abstract

Dynamic data replication improves data accessibility in mobile ad hoc networks. In our previous works, we proposed few methods to manage locations of replicas and efficiently forward access requests to the locations. In this paper, we extend these methods to adapt to an environment where data items are updated. The extended methods predict the locations of data items by storing and using the information on replica allocation at every relocation time and the logs of past data accesses. In addition, these methods give the priority to the stored information and access logs according to update and access times of the replicas.
